  6. Just to clarify that a touch, you dont get free entry to ALL events at Waneroo raceway with WASCC membership. Private events, such as NO LIMITS for example are not covered as its not a WASCC Event. However, it is still an excellent club at an excellent price if you attend enough events, plus you get the practise days quite cheap.
  7. Hey guys, Just thought i would give out some information on getting yourself a "Competition License" so you can compete in up coming events be it AHG, Wanneroo or a whole bunch of other events. You will need one of 2 licenses. The CAMS License covers basically all events and venues in Perth (some exceptions of course). The the option is the AASA license which covers all events at AHG Driving Centre. To get a CAMS License you need to be a member of a CAMS affiliated Club (SAUWA is not CAMS Affiliated) however there is several Perth clubs that are. All Fours and Rotaries, WASCC or even No Limit Events (Conditions apply with No Limits Events). Cost of the CAMS License is $88 per year, plus you car club membership. This is a very handy license to have if you want to do several forms of events. If you need any further info on this, check out CAMS website: http://www.cams.com.au Option 2 is the very cost effective AASA (Australian Auto Sport Alliance) license. THIS LICENSE IS ONLY USEABLE ON LIMITED EVENTS! This license is useable for all AHG/MC Motorsport events. Weather it be an MC Motorsport Autotest, or Sprint Series, or even a Club event, this license is permitted. The cost of this license is $50 per year. This gives excellent value for the occasional race at AHG. All our SAUWA Timed events will require this license at a minimum! If you need more details about this, check their website: http://www.australianautosportalliance.com I hope this infomation helps you out. SAUWA Is planning timed events for members in the new year so we suggest that you organise your license soon.   16. Fulcrum Suspension is the Authorised Australian Agent for Tein. They are the ones who can repair Teins with genuine Tein parts (seals, valves etc) If you would like to tell me the problem you are having with said shock, i can give you an idea on price to fix it as I work for the WA Agent for Tein
